Glossary Styling
OpenMetadata supports glossary styling using colors and icons. Users can get a one-glance view of the related concepts and terms by color-coding the terms and by adding icons. When the glossary terms are color-coded and used for tagging the data assets, it is easier to differentiate and identify the data assets visually.
To stylize your glossary terms:
- Navigate to the glossary term to be edited.
- Click on the 3 dots icon ⋮ and click on style

- Add a link to the icon image. You can also change the font color. Click on Submit to save the changes.

When data assets are tagged with the Glossary terms, the color-coding helps for easier identification of the required data assets.
